ISE student, Talia Zaverdinos, placed in the top 3 for the 2019 Outstanding ISE Capstone Senior Design Project at the recent IISE Annual Conference in Orlando, Florida. The award recognizes individual students or teams that have applied their ISE knowledge and skills to have a significant impact on an organization. A selection committee screened applicants down to the top 20. The top 20 were poster boarded and there was a showcase where a committee evaluated posters and interviewed students. The top 3 were selected and announced at the Council on Industrial and Systems Engineering (CISE) Leadership Mixer on Sunday night. 

Talia graduated in May and earned her Green Belt certification based on her project at Abbott Nutrition.  She is headed to the University of Edinburgh for a Masters in Business Analytics.
